20 / 91 page ![]() 6 MHz 12 MHz 16 MHz 1.8 V 2.2 V 2.7 V 3.3 V 3.6 V Supply Voltage −V Supply voltage range, during flash memory programming Supply voltage range, during program execution Legend : MSP430F20x3 MSP430F20x2 MSP430F20x1 SLAS491G – AUGUST 2005 – REVISED APRIL 2011 www.ti.com Absolute Maximum Ratings (1) Voltage applied at VCC to VSS -0.3 V to 4.1 V Voltage applied to any pin(2) -0.3 V to VCC + 0.3 V Diode current at any device terminal ±2 mA Unprogrammed device -55 °C to 150°C Tstg Storage temperature(3) Programmed device -40 °C to 150°C (1) Stresses beyond those listed under "absolute maximum ratings" may cause permanent damage to the device. These are stress ratings only, and functional operation of the device at these or any other conditions beyond those indicated under "recommended operating conditions " is not implied. Exposure to absolute-maximum-rated conditions for extended periods may affect device reliability. (2) All voltages referenced to VSS. The JTAG fuse-blow voltage, VFB, is allowed to exceed the absolute maximum rating. The voltage is applied to the TEST pin when blowing the JTAG fuse. (3) Higher temperature may be applied during board soldering according to the current JEDEC J-STD-020 specification with peak reflow temperatures not higher than classified on the device label on the shipping boxes or reels. Recommended Operating Conditions MIN NOM MAX UNIT During program execution 1.8 3.6 VCC Supply voltage V During flash program/erase 2.2 3.6 VSS Supply voltage 0 V I version -40 85 TA Operating free-air temperature °C T version -40 105 VCC = 1.8 V, dc 6 Duty cycle = 50% ± 10% fSYSTE VCC = 2.7 V, Processor frequency (maximum MCLK frequency)(1)(2) dc 12 MHz M Duty cycle = 50% ± 10% VCC ≥ 3.3 V, dc 16 Duty cycle = 50% ± 10% (1) The MSP430 CPU is clocked directly with MCLK. Both the high and low phase of MCLK must not exceed the pulse width of the specified maximum frequency. (2) Modules might have a different maximum input clock specification. See the specification of the respective module in this data sheet. Note: Minimum processor frequency is defined by system clock. Flash program or erase operations require a minimum VCC of 2.2 V.
